Avoiding the Wrong Traffic

A plumber in Melbourne does not need traffic from people searching for “DIY tap repair.” A local dentist does not want clicks from another state. A builder does not want students researching renovation ideas for an assignment. These clicks may look like activity, but they are not useful. They quietly spend your budget and leave you wondering why nothing is coming back. We think about the small details that business owners often do not have time to check. FAQs

How long does Google Ads take to show results?

Some businesses start seeing clicks and enquiries within a few days, especially for local services people search for regularly. But good results usually improve over time as the campaign gets adjusted, keywords are refined, and wasted spending is reduced. Google Ads is not just about launching ads quickly, it is about improving them consistently.

Is Google Ads suitable for small businesses in Melbourne?

Yes, especially for local businesses that rely on enquiries, bookings, or phone calls. A small business does not need a massive budget to benefit from Google Ads. What matters more is targeting the right audience and making sure the ads reach people who are genuinely searching for the service.

Why were my previous Google Ads campaigns not working?

There can be many reasons. Sometimes the wrong keywords are targeted. Sometimes ads are shown outside the service area. In other cases, the website or landing page may not encourage people to take action. Many businesses spend money on clicks without properly tracking whether those clicks are turning into leads or customers.
